Commemoration of the Great Escape

On Sunday the 24th March, Wemians gathered at the War Memorial to remember the 75th Anniversery of the “Great Escape and the execution of 50 escapees”.   One of their number was Flt Lt C D Swain who grew up in Wem and was baptised in Wem Parish Church,  before joining the Royal Air Force in August of 1936.   As a member of 105 Sqn flying a Blenhelm Mk IV Pathfinder aircraft,  he was shot down over Dusseldorf,  captured and became a POW, he was eventually imprisioned at Stalag Luft III.   After the escape (on the night of 24/25th March 1944) he was apprehended and subsequently executed,  with the other 49 chosen on the direct order of Adolf Hitler, on the 31st March 1944.   The Service was concluded in the church with a wreath dedicated to his memory and the opportunity  to view his baptism  record.
